The Legend of the Re-Pizza
The rumors usually go like this: kids order pizza at Chuck E. Cheese. Some don't finish their slices. Then, a resourceful employee gathers those uneaten pieces.
Next, they allegedly Frankenstein these leftovers together. The result? A brand new, slightly suspect, pizza pie. Ready to be served to unsuspecting customers!

Is There Any Truth to It?
Chuck E. Cheese has vehemently denied these allegations for years. They claim their pizza is made fresh. They insist on strict food safety standards.
But the rumors persist! Maybe because the idea is just too good to let go.
Ultimately, it's probably just a myth. A fun, silly story that's become part of internet lore.
